BlogDocs

fix: Support `pydantic.Field(repr=False)` in dataclasses(#8511)

Merged
Merging
tigeryy2:fix/dataclass-field-repr
into
main
0%
IMPROVEMENTS
0
REGRESSIONS
0
UNTOUCHED
10
NEW
0
DROPPED
0
IGNORED
0

Benchmarks

test_fastapi_startup_perf
tests/benchmarks/test_fastapi_startup_generics.py::test_fastapi_startup_perf
-2%
3.6 s
3.7 s
test_fastapi_startup_perf
tests/benchmarks/test_fastapi_startup_simple.py::test_fastapi_startup_perf
0%
1.3 s
1.3 s
test_north_star_dump_json
tests/benchmarks/test_north_star.py::test_north_star_dump_json
-1%
194.8 ms
196.2 ms
test_north_star_dump_python
tests/benchmarks/test_north_star.py::test_north_star_dump_python
+1%
76.9 ms
76.4 ms
test_north_star_json_dumps
tests/benchmarks/test_north_star.py::test_north_star_json_dumps
-1%
188.1 ms
189.8 ms
test_north_star_json_loads
tests/benchmarks/test_north_star.py::test_north_star_json_loads
-1%
97.2 ms
98.6 ms
test_north_star_validate_json
tests/benchmarks/test_north_star.py::test_north_star_validate_json
+5%
351.4 ms
335.8 ms
test_north_star_validate_json_strict
tests/benchmarks/test_north_star.py::test_north_star_validate_json_strict
+5%
346.9 ms
330.7 ms
test_north_star_validate_python
tests/benchmarks/test_north_star.py::test_north_star_validate_python
+1%
180.7 ms
178.5 ms
test_north_star_validate_python_strict
tests/benchmarks/test_north_star.py::test_north_star_validate_python_strict
-2%
108.2 ms
110.1 ms

Commits

Click on a commit to change the comparison range
base
main
e4fa099
0%
fix: Support `pydantic.Field(repr=False)` in dataclasses Why What - Modified `make_pydantic_fields_compatible` to address `repr` - Added test for `repr` support Notes
bba4863
4 months ago by tigeryy2
+1%
Parameterize Field tests in test_dataclasses for simplicity Why What Notes
5cdd7a3
4 months ago by tigeryy2
ResourcesHomePricingDocsBlogGitHub
Copyright © 2024 CodSpeed Technology SAS. All rights reserved.